The resolver reads PIN_MODE (set to strict), PIN_AUDIT_INTERVAL (hours between lockfile audits), and PIN_FAIL_OPEN (must be false in production). Floating ranges are rejected at build time; exceptions require a waiver recorded in the policy register. The resolver also verifies signed lockfiles against our internal registry, and it authenticates to that registry with a credential defined in the environment file on the line immediately following this paragraph.

vault entry, kadup-bafog: COURIER_KEY5=6648d

When exporting spreadsheets through the Gridwell Export API, be mindful that large workbooks are materialized fully in memory before streaming begins. For exports above 50,000 rows, always set the `chunked=true` flag so the service writes incrementally and keeps heap usage under the 512 MB worker limit. Requests to the internal export tier must authenticate with the key below.

API key for tajog-bajof: kto15_6fvgvYZbOKdLifh

Hey folks — handing off LiftPath release duties to Mara while I'm out. The elevator-dispatch simulator ships Thursdays; build 4.2 is staged and the scenario packs are frozen. Only gotcha: the dispatch-core artifact won't promote unless it's signed before the smoke suite kicks off, so do that first, not after. Everything else is in the runbook on the Ostermill wiki. Mara, you'll need the deploy key to push to the release channel, so pasting it here for the sync notes.

deploy key for tawip-bawig: bky13_1zSxDtVxnNkjh